Can a Whiteboard Be Used as a Projector Screen? Exploring the Possibilities

The answer is yes, a whiteboard can be used as a projector screen, but there are some considerations to keep in mind before doing so.

First, the quality of the image displayed on a whiteboard may not be as sharp and clear as on a dedicated projector screen. This is because whiteboards are not designed and optimized for projection purposes like projector screens are. The surface of a whiteboard also tends to reflect more light, which can cause a glare and make the image harder to see.

However, with the right setup and some adjustments, a whiteboard can still serve as a good alternative to a projector screen in certain situations. For example, if you only need to display simple images or text, a whiteboard can be a convenient option. It can also be useful in environments where a projector screen is not available or practical, such as in a classroom or conference room where a whiteboard is already present.

To use a whiteboard as a projector screen, you will need to take some steps to improve the quality of the image. One option is to apply a white projector screen paint to the surface of the whiteboard. This will create a dedicated projection surface that is optimized for displaying images clearly and sharply. Another option is to adjust the projector settings to reduce the brightness and contrast, which can help to minimize the glare and improve the visibility of the image.

In conclusion, while a whiteboard may not be the optimal choice for a projector screen, it can still serve as a viable alternative in many situations. By taking some simple steps to optimize the setup, you can use a whiteboard effectively to display images and information for your audience.

Can a Whiteboard Be Used as a Projector Screen? The Pros and Cons

When it comes to projecting images and videos onto a surface, there are a variety of screen options available - from traditional projector screens to walls and even sheets. However, one option that is often overlooked is the humble whiteboard. But can a whiteboard really be used as a projector screen? Lets break down the pros and cons.

Pros:

1. Versatility: One of the biggest advantages of using a whiteboard as a screen is its versatility. Unlike traditional screens, whiteboards can be written on with markers. This makes them an ideal choice for interactive presentations and meetings where you need to highlight and annotate information in real-time.

2. Affordability: Another benefit of using a whiteboard as a screen is cost-effectiveness. Traditional screens can be expensive, but whiteboards are relatively inexpensive and widely available.

3. Large size: Whiteboards typically come in larger sizes than traditional screens, making them ideal for presentations to larger audiences or in bigger spaces.

Cons:

1. Reflections: One of the biggest drawbacks of using a whiteboard as a screen is the potential for unwanted reflections. The glossy surface of a whiteboard can bounce light back to the audience, causing glare and making it difficult to see the projected image.

2. Image quality: Another potential issue with using a whiteboard as a screen is the quality of the image. The surface of a whiteboard is not specifically designed for projecting images, which can result in a distorted or unclear image.

3. Surface damage: Finally, using a whiteboard as a screen can lead to surface damage over time. Projector bulbs can generate a significant amount of heat, which can cause the whiteboard surface to warp or bubble.

In conclusion, while using a whiteboard as a projector screen can be a cost-effective and versatile choice, it is not without its drawbacks. Reflections, poor image quality, and surface damage are all potential issues to consider before making this choice. However, with proper setup and maintenance, a whiteboard can provide a compelling presentation or meeting experience, with the added bonus of interactive features.

Can a Whiteboard be Used as a Projector Screen: A Comprehensive Guide

Projector screens are an essential element in various domains, ranging from business presentations to home theatre setups. However, buying a projector screen can be expensive, and not everyone is willing to invest in it. This raises the question of whether a simple whiteboard can be used as a projector screen. In this article, we will investigate this possibility and help you determine whether a whiteboard is a suitable replacement for a projector screen.

Firstly, let us understand how projectors work. Projectors project an image by shining a bright light through a small lens onto a surface. This surface reflects back the light, creating an enlarged version of the image. A projector screen is designed for this purpose, as it is made of materials that maximize the reflection of light.

Now, let us consider a whiteboard. Whiteboards are designed to be written on with markers and then erased. The surface is made of a glossy material that is easy to clean. However, this glossy surface is not suitable for projecting images. It reflects light in a different way which can distort the image and reduce the quality of the projected image.

Therefore, it is not recommended to use a whiteboard as a substitute for a projector screen, mainly due to the impact on image quality. Additionally, it is not practical to use a whiteboard as a screen due to its material property. It may work in a pinch, but you will not get the benefits of a proper projector screen.

In conclusion, while a whiteboard may seem like a good alternative to a projector screen, it is not ideal in terms of image quality, and using it regularly may damage the whiteboard surface. Therefore, it is recommended to invest in a proper projector screen for a better visual experience.

Can a Whiteboard be Used as a Projector Screen: Pros and Cons

In todays tech-savvy world, projectors have become a popular choice for delivering presentations, holding meetings, or even organizing movie nights at home. While traditional projector screens are readily available, many people wonder if they can use a whiteboard instead. The answer is yes, but with a few caveats.

The first thing to consider is the type of projector youll be using. Some projectors work better with whiteboards because of their reflection, while others work better with traditional screens because of their surface. Unfortunately, not all projectors are created equal, and not all whiteboards are created equal either.

One important factor to consider is the aspect ratio of your whiteboard. Most projectors are optimized for 16:9 ratio, so using a whiteboard thats a different size may throw off the picture quality. Additionally, the material of your whiteboard will also play an important role. Dry-erase whiteboards have a glossy finish that can cause glare, which may make it difficult to see the images clearly on the screen.

However, there are also some advantages to using a whiteboard as a projector screen. First, whiteboards are cheaper and more portable than traditional projector screens. Theyre also easier to install and take down, making them perfect for people who are always on the go.

Another great aspect of whiteboards is their versatility. When youre not using them as a projector screen, they can be used for things like note-taking, brainstorming, or even drawing. This added functionality makes whiteboards a great option for classrooms, offices, or even at home.

However, its worth noting that using a whiteboard as a projector screen may not give you the same picture quality as a traditional projector screen. The images may not be as crisp or as high in contrast, which may make it difficult to see if youre using small text or detailed images. That being said, for most people, the difference wont be noticeable, and the added convenience of using a whiteboard can easily make up for any slight loss in picture quality.

In conclusion, using a whiteboard as a projector screen is a viable option, but its important to consider the caveats. Make sure to test the whiteboard with your projector before using it for an important presentation, and be aware that the picture quality may not be as high as with a traditional screen. However, the convenience, portability, and added functionality of using a whiteboard can make it a great option for those in need of a quick and easy solution for their presentation needs.
